Vaughan seems to be the king in an informal survey Internal Correspondence conducted among 11 comic stores across the United States and Canada. Saga is now a perennial, Paper Girls is a smash hit, We Stand on Guard sold solidly, and The Private Eye is a $50 hardcover.
